(a)(1) An applicant shall submit an application for a Program grant on the form that the Secretary requires.
(2) The applicant may submit an application to the Program at the same time the applicant applies for support from a county comparable program.
(b) The Program shall review the application and all supporting materials in order to evaluate whether the applicant qualifies for a grant from the Program.
(c)(1) Subject to the availability of money in the Fund, the Program may provide to an eligible business a grant that equals the amount of the grant that the county comparable program provides to the business.
(2) The Program shall provide the grants described under paragraph (1) of this subsection on a first-come, first-served basis.
(d) The Program shall coordinate with county comparable programs to evaluate applications and to provide assistance to eligible businesses under this subtitle.
